Qatar, Inuwa Foundations Donate Motorcycles, Sewing Machines, Laptops to 500 People in Jigawa

No fewer than 500 persons, comprising men and women including persons with disabilities, have received various empowerment tools donated by the Qatar Foundation in collaboration with Mallam Inuwa Foundation in Jigawa State.

The Foundation is an initiative of Mallam Kashifu Inuwa Abdullahi, Director of the National Information Technology Development Agency, NITDA.

The presentations of the empowerment items were made at Inuwa Foundation Headquarters in Hadejia local government area of Jigawa State on Monday.

According to the Chairman of the Mallam Inuwa Foundation, Dr. Hussaini Yusuf Baba, 200 women were empowered with sewing machines, while another 300 received grinding machines.

“We also gave out three computers, 13 Carpentry tools and 13 motorcycles to some disabled persons.

“This is part of the foundation vision of supporting people especially the needy with the support of Qatar Charity,” he said.

He added that the foundations had organised eye medical outreach that provided surgery and medications for people with eyes problem in Jigawa.

He expressed gratitude to the Qatar Foundation for its immense support particularly Sheikh Khalid Al Dohawy who took participated actively in the programme.

On his part, Jigawa Deputy Governor, Mallam Umar Namadi, who represented the Governor, Alh. Badaru Abubakar, thanked Mallam Inuwa Foundation for always supporting the less privilege, women and youths in the State.

Emir of Hadeija, Alhaji Adamu Abubakar Maje, commended the efforts of the founder of Mallam Inuwa Foundation, Kashifu Inuwa Abdullahi, for attracting development to Hadejia town and Jigawa State, in extension.

“We are proud of this Foundation. We are also proud of its founder. We have a worthy son that did not forget his people by addressing their demands. Kashifu is a model for all of us, from what we have seen,” Alh. Abubakar Maje said.

The dignitaries later inspected a piece of land allocated for building 50 Houses fir the needy, a school and a Mosque at Bariki, a few minutes drive from the Emir’s palace.

The building is part of the Qatar Charity support programmes and was facilitated by Mallam Inuwa Foundation.

The event was well attended by local government Chairmen, Commissioners and State Assembly members.
